enVVeno Medical Corporation (NASDAQ:NVNO – Get Free Report) was the recipient of a significant decline in short interest during the month of June. As of June 15th, there was short interest totaling 14,788 shares, a decline of 78.9% from the May 31st total of 70,022 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 7,743 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 1.9 days. Currently, 2.6% of the shares of the stock are short sold.
enVVeno Medical Stock Up 2.5%
NVNO traded up $0.27 during midday trading on Monday, hitting $11.11. 364 shares of the company were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 16,119. The firm’s 50 day moving average price is $10.77 and its 200-day moving average price is $10.98. enVVeno Medical has a 1-year low of $8.67 and a 1-year high of $196.70. The firm has a market capitalization of $7.42 million, a P/E ratio of -0.44 and a beta of 1.10.
enVVeno Medical (NASDAQ:NVNO –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 7th. The company reported ($5.89)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of ($8.40) by $2.51.

Institutional Inflows and Outflows
Hedge funds have recently made changes to their positions in the business. ACT Capital Management LLC bought a new stake in shares of enVVeno Medical during the 4th quarter valued at about $37,000. Jane Street Group LLC bought a new position in shares of enVVeno Medical during the 2nd quarter worth approximately $51,000. Creative Planning acquired a new stake in shares of enVVeno Medical during the 2nd quarter worth approximately $54,000. CM Management LLC increased its stake in shares of enVVeno Medical by 108.3% in the 4th quarter. CM Management LLC now owns 1,250,000 shares of the company’s stock valued at $401,000 after acquiring an additional 650,000 shares in the last quarter. Finally, Geode Capital Management LLC lifted its position in shares of enVVeno Medical by 1.1% during the 2nd quarter. Geode Capital Management LLC now owns 199,509 shares of the company’s stock valued at $796,000 after acquiring an additional 2,211 shares during the period. 34.71% of the stock is owned by institutional investors.
enVVeno Medical Company Profile
enVVeno Medical, Inc is a clinical?stage medical device company focused on the development and commercialization of subcutaneous vascular access systems for patients requiring repeated or long?term intravenous therapy. Through its proprietary Freedom® platform, the company aims to offer an implantable alternative to traditional peripherally inserted central catheters (PICCs) and external tunneled catheters, addressing complications such as infection risk, dislodgement and patient discomfort.
The company’s lead product candidate, the Freedom PICC System, consists of a low?profile, subcutaneous port connected to a flexible catheter designed for peripheral insertion.
